Full job description
This role owns a retail market data product at Cox Automotive end to end - from data acquisition and cleansing through publication and consumer adoption. This data product provides comprehensive retail vehicle listing coverage across the US and Canada, enabling dealers to benchmark market pricing for their inventory and powering analytics and data science capabilities across the enterprise. This is a data ownership role. You will be the authority on this data product - responsible for its quality, coverage, and evolution as the retail vehicle market changes, and for guiding internal consumers on how to interpret and use the data for their needs.

What You'll Do
Data Ownership & Stewardship
- Own the data product end to end - cleansing, quality standards, coverage, and publication
- Contribute to data sourcing and acquisition strategy, including evaluating new data sources and expanding coverage into new markets
- Serve as the go-to authority on this data product, guiding internal teams on how to interpret and use the data effectively
- Engage with stakeholders to evaluate new use cases, uncover pain points, and determine where changes to the data product are needed to deliver business value
- Define and track data quality, coverage, freshness, and adoption metrics
- Evolve the data product as the retail vehicle selling market changes - understanding what dealers care about when pricing inventory and how that translates to data requirements
Execution & Delivery
- Ensure product requirements are accounted for in the modernization and growth roadmap for this data product, partnering with engineering and architecture to inform pipeline and infrastructure decisions
- Lead product execution across 2 engineering delivery teams using Agile methodologies
- Maintain a well-prioritized backlog with clearly defined requirements and acceptance criteria
Stakeholder & Vendor Management
- Engage stakeholders at all levels to align priorities and communicate trade-offs
- Participate in external data vendor partner discussions, including data quality expectations and expansion opportunities
- Partner with front-end product teams who consume this data product to ensure it evolves to support their roadmaps
- Collaborate with data science and analytics teams who use this data for enterprise reporting, forecasting, and insights
- Translate technical data product decisions into business impact for non-technical audiences
Who You Are
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ant discipline and 6+ years of experience in a related field, or a master's degree and 4+ years of experience, or 10+ years of experience in a related field
- 6+ years of experience in Product Management, Analytics, or related roles, preferably with back-end data products, data platforms, or data pipeline products
- Proficient in writing SQL and querying data to understand product quality, coverage, and stakeholder use cases
- Strong understanding of data products, APIs, data pipelines, and cloud data platforms
- Comfortable participating in technical data flow and architecture discussions
- Excellent communication skills with demonstrated ability to present to leadership and translate technical concepts for business audiences
Preferred Qualifications
- Understanding of the retail automotive market and dealer pricing dynamics
- Experience with data stewardship, data governance, or data quality management
- Experience managing external vendor relationships
- Familiarity with Agile methodologies and backlog management tools (Rally preferred)
